What Is an Emotional Intelligence Test Manual?

An emotional intelligence test manual is a comprehensive document that accompanies an

EI assessment instrument. It serves as both a reference and instructional guide for users.

Unlike casual questionnaires or self-help quizzes, formal EI tests require structured

administration and interpretation, which is where the manual becomes invaluable.

The manual usually contains:

Background information about emotional intelligence and the theory behind the test

Step-by-step instructions on how to administer the test

Guidelines for scoring and calculating results

Normative data or benchmarks for comparison

Interpretation tips to understand what scores mean

Recommendations for feedback delivery and practical application

By following the manual closely, practitioners can ensure that the test results are valid,

reliable, and meaningful.

Key Components of a Manual of Emotional Intelligence Test

1. Theoretical Foundation and Test Purpose

A good manual always begins by outlining the theoretical framework underpinning the

emotional intelligence test. Emotional intelligence is often broken down into several

domains, such as self-awareness, self-regulation, social skills, empathy, and motivation.

Explaining these domains helps users understand what the test measures and why.

Additionally, the manual clarifies the specific purpose of the test. Is it designed for

personal development, clinical diagnosis, employee selection, or educational assessment?

Clarifying this helps set expectations and guides appropriate usage.

2. Detailed Administration Instructions

Clear instructions on how to administer the test ensure consistency across different users

and settings. The manual specifies whether the test is self-report or ability-based, the

estimated time to complete, materials needed, and any environmental considerations.

For example, some EI tests require a quiet space and direct supervision, while others can

be completed online or remotely. The manual may also address accommodations for

participants with disabilities or language barriers.

3. Scoring Procedures and Norms

Perhaps the most technical part of the manual, scoring instructions must be precise and

easy to follow. It explains how to tally responses, calculate subscale scores, and derive an

overall emotional intelligence score.

Normative data plays a crucial role here. The manual often provides comparative tables

showing average scores by age, gender, cultural background, or professional group. This

helps practitioners contextualize individual results and identify strengths or areas for

growth.

4. Interpretation Guidelines

Scores alone have limited value without meaningful interpretation. A comprehensive

manual guides users on how to interpret various score ranges and patterns. For instance,

a low score in emotional regulation might indicate a need for stress management training,

while high social skills scores could suggest strong interpersonal abilities.

Interpretation sections may also include case examples or profiles to illustrate how to

translate numbers into actionable insights.

5. Ethical Considerations and Limitations

Responsible use of emotional intelligence tests requires awareness of ethical issues. The

manual typically reminds users about confidentiality, informed consent, and appropriate

feedback delivery.

It also discusses the test’s limitations — no assessment is perfect, and emotional

intelligence is complex and dynamic. Recognizing these limitations encourages users to

combine test results with other information sources.

Common Types of Emotional Intelligence Tests and Their Manuals

Several popular emotional intelligence assessments come with detailed manuals tailored

to their unique approaches. Here are a few examples:

Mayer-Salovey-Caruso Emotional Intelligence Test (MSCEIT): An ability-

1.

based test with a manual emphasizing performance scoring and emotional problem-

solving skills.

Emotional Quotient Inventory (EQ-i 2.0): A self-report measure with a

2.

comprehensive manual covering administration, scoring, and interpretation focused

on workplace applications.

Trait Emotional Intelligence Questionnaire (TEIQue): Measures personality-

3.

based emotional traits, with manuals that provide nuanced insights into self-

perceptions of emotional abilities.

Each test manual reflects the unique theory and purpose behind its instrument, so

selecting the right one depends on your specific needs.

Comparative Insights: Different Manuals and Their Approaches

While manuals share common elements, notable differences exist depending on the test’s

orientation and target population. For instance, the EQ-i manual prioritizes practical

applications in workplace settings and includes extensive normative data segmented by

age, gender, and cultural background. In contrast, the MSCEIT manual emphasizes

cognitive processing of emotional information, providing exhaustive detail on scoring

based on expert consensus and consensus scoring models.

Such variations reflect divergent philosophies in EI measurement: self-report versus

ability-based assessments. Consequently, users must carefully select the manual and test

that align with their assessment goals. The manual also offers insight into test limitations,

such as potential social desirability bias in self-reports or cultural biases in emotional

scenario interpretation.

Reliability and Validity: What the Manual Reveals

A critical function of any emotional intelligence test manual is to present empirical

evidence supporting the instrument’s psychometric soundness. Reliability indices, like

internal consistency and test-retest reliability, reassure users about the stability of scores

over time. Validity data, encompassing content, construct, and criterion-related validity,

demonstrate that the test measures EI as intended and predicts relevant outcomes such

as job performance or psychological well-being.

For example, the manual of a robust EI test might report Cronbach’s alpha values

exceeding 0.80 across subscales, indicating high internal consistency. It may also present

correlational studies linking EI scores with leadership effectiveness or academic success,

thereby reinforcing the test’s practical relevance.

Challenges in Manual Utilization and Interpretation

Despite detailed guidance, the manual of emotional intelligence test cannot fully eliminate

challenges faced by practitioners. One common issue is the complexity of interpreting

nuanced emotional competencies, which may require supplemental training or

supervision. Additionally, cultural differences in emotional expression and perception may

affect test validity, and manuals often acknowledge the need for localized norming or

adaptation.

Furthermore, some manuals may lack sufficient guidance for atypical populations, such as

individuals with neurodivergent profiles, which can lead to misinterpretations. Therefore,

ongoing research and updates to the manual are vital to maintain relevance and

accuracy.
